  • Why is my fridge making weird noises?

    A few culprits that cause your fridge to make weird noises include a vibrating fan – the fan can sometimes become imbalanced or loose, causing a whirring or clicking sound. Defrosting cycles – as ice melts from your refrigerator coil, it can make noise. Water flow issues – if your fridge has a water dispenser or ice maker, there can be noises associated with water flow or ice cube creation. A simple cleaning or adjustment to your refrigerator can improve the noisiness; however, if the noise is new, loud, or concerning, it’s best to call our refrigerator repair specialists for a prompt diagnosis and solution.

  • How do I keep my fridge running smoothly?

    A Regular maintenance is vital to a happy fridge. Here are some easy tips to follow:

    • Clean the condenser coils—These help release heat, and dust buildup can make your refrigerator work harder. Vacuuming them a few times a year can help immensely.

    • Check your door seal, ensuring they are clean and secure to prevent cool air from escaping.

    • Avoid overloading your fridge with groceries. Refrigerators need good air circulation to function correctly. 

    • Keep it level – A tilted fridge can strain the compressor and lead to noise or inefficiency.

  • Can I fix my refrigerator myself, or should I call a pro?

    Simple DIY fixes are possible, like cleaning coils or replacing a water filter. However, it's best to call a professional for more complex issues, like a faulty thermostat or refrigerant leak.
